Latest Patents:

Lem's recent patents highlight his expertise in improving automotive seating comfort. One of his groundbreaking inventions is the "Ventilated seat and method for ventilating a seat." This invention provides a seat with ventilation openings arranged on the seat surface, a ventilation device, ventilation channels, and flow control devices. By incorporating sensors and a smart control unit, the system efficiently adjusts ventilation based on the applied force, pressure, and other factors. This innovation promises enhanced comfort in long journeys and hot climates.

Another remarkable patent by Lem is the "Method for adjusting the seat of a vehicle." This method captures loading data of the seat and evaluates it to determine a control dataset. Based on this dataset, the seat is periodically adjusted to optimize comfort. This invention presents a novel approach to personalized seating, ensuring a comfortable and ergonomic experience for occupants.
